PAUL L. SERFF RECEIVES LIFETIME ACHIEVEMENT AWARD FOR CONTRIBUTIONS TO TEXAS TOURISM

(Austin, TX), September 26, 2011 – In honor of his lifetime contributions to the travel and tourism industry in Texas and the United States, the Texas Travel Industry Association (TTIA) presented its Lifetime Achievement Award to Paul L. Serff. Paul, President Emeritus of TTIA, received the award on September 19, 2011 during the association’s annual Texas Travel Summit Conference held in San Antonio. Nanci Liles, Executive Director of the Abilene Convention & Visitors Bureau made the award presentation on behalf of TTIA.

Paul’s contributions to tourism in Texas and across the nation have spanned five decades and helped shape the industry. Paul worked his way up from an assistant personnel director for Hershey Entertainment & Resort Company, to vice president and general manager of Fiesta Texas, to the President and CEO of the Texas Travel Industry Association, a position he held for more than 12 years.

Paul stepped-down as the President & CEO of the Texas Travel Industry Association in 2010, but remains an integral part of the organization as President Emeritus. Paul is also very active with other travel & tourism organizations including: Managing Partner of the Serff Group, a travel and tourism consulting firm; a board and executive committee member of the Destination and Travel Foundation and a representative of that foundation on the US Travel Association Board; a board member of IAAPA Foundation; and a member of the US Travel Association’s Communication Committee and IAAPA’s Government Relations Committee.

When asked about the 2011 Lifetime Achievement Recipient, TTIA President and CEO, David Teel, commented, "Paul Serff’s life is filled with examples of his commitment not only to the industry, but also to his family, friends and colleagues. He is an integral part of the travel and tourism industry in Texas and his dedication is unsurpassed.”

"What a good way to make a life, doing what you love, with the people you love," Paul said during his acceptance speech.

The Lifetime Achievement Award is given to an individual nominated from the TTIA membership as one of the industry's most prestigious honors for lifetime contributions to TTIA and the betterment of travel and tourism.
